A "flat character" is essentially a character who doesn't change throughout a story. They are seen as "stagnant" and remain the same, so it doesn't affect the storyline.

Let's compare this definition to the options you have.

〜 Option a)
A lonely man who discovers his true friends when he has an emergency

ヽ The description we derive from this sentence is that the man is lonely, but eventually discovers his "true friends" when facing an emergency. This change in events means that the character's life has things going on and changes how the man used to be lonely, and instead one may describe him to be surrounded by those who love him; he may be a grateful man rather than a lonely one.

〜 Option b)
A bank teller who refuses to let the main character complete a transaction

Because no further details are given about what happens in the story, we are given the general idea of the bank teller constantly refusing to let the main character complete a transaction. This event is therefore repetitive and constant, meaning the bank teller is an example of a flat character.

〜 Option c)
A spoiled teen who learns to care for people who are less fortunate

The spoiled teen is described to gradually learn to care for the less fortunate, revealing that the character undergoes a change from being ungrateful and careless to being empathetic to those that are less fortunate. This is a change in character and so therefore the spoiled teen in the story is not a flat character.

〜 Option d)
A small, nervous child who grows into a strong and powerful wizard

Because it is said that the child starts off as being "small" and nervous, who then transforms into a strong and powerful wizard, the character's personality stands to represent a kind of oxymoron. This change in persona is a clear indicator of the character being anything but "flat".

What two elements of education have evolved since colonial times?

Answers

The answer would be most likely Mathematics and Grammar.

Answer:

The two Education elements that evolved since colonial times were the Birth of the public schools and universities.

Explanation:

During the Colonial Era people only belonging to middle and upper class were allowed to learn.

In the 17th century, were the first American school opened. Boston Latin School, founded in 1635, is the first and the oldest existing school in the US. Colonists during that period first tried to educate people by the traditional English methods of family, church, etc.

Emphasis was made to educate people after the Revolution so that they can read the Bible.

Harvard College was founded in 1636, by the colonial legislature, named after its benefactor. Funds were collected from the colonies to run the universities.

The pros and cons of using propaganda in an essay are varied and relate to the intent behind its use. On one hand, propaganda can help organize and clarify ideas to support a viewpoint and allow students to focus on the essay's content. On the other hand, it can be manipulative, misrepresent facts to endorse a certain perspective, and build support for policies or actions that the public might not naturally align with.

Benefits of propaganda include its ability to mobilize people for causes like the American Revolution or to promote political movements. For instance, Franklin's 'Join or Die' illustration effectively rallied support. However, the strategic omission of information, such as the dangers of war on recruitment posters, depicts the skewed nature of propaganda.

Moreover, the transition towards digital propaganda introduces new challenges, as the internet acts as both a propaganda machine and a fact-checking tool. Without proper education in discerning fact from fiction online, propaganda can easily be the winning force over truth.
